Easy Party-Perfect Pulp Fiction Cocktail Recipe You Can Mix at Home

Date:

Looking for a vibrant cocktail to kickstart your next house party? This refreshed Pulp Fiction cocktail recipe is exactly what you need to impress your guests with minimal effort. This easy-to-make drink combines the crispness of fresh apple juice and the earthy depth of cold-pressed beetroot juice with a splash of vodka for a bold and refreshing sip.

Pulp Fiction Cocktail Ingredients

For two servings, gather:

  • 40 ml vodka
  • 60 ml fresh apple juice
  • 20 ml cold-pressed beetroot juice
  • 15 ml freshly squeezed lemon juice
  • 10 ml vanilla syrup
  • Plenty of ice

How to Mix Your Pulp Fiction Drink

  1. Pour the vodka, apple juice, beetroot juice, lemon juice, and vanilla syrup into a cocktail shaker.
  2. Add a generous amount of ice and shake it all up vigorously for around 10–15 seconds to chill and blend the flavours.
  3. Strain the cocktail through a fine strainer into a chilled coupe or rocks glass. If you prefer, add fresh ice to your rocks glass.
  4. For an elegant touch, garnish with a thin slice of apple or an orange twist. Serve immediately and enjoy this party-perfect drink.
